Transaction 51fa96a3872f2622cc05ca5bce09a891f4842a1b72e57d1a5fd2790dc2bd650a

1 Input
2 Outputs
  • 51fa96a3872f2622cc05ca5bce09a891f4842a1b72e57d1a5fd2790dc2bd650a:0
  • value  150800
    address  3AVz8HbmQRKHe7jGBdhzKDQbuRk6SsBECV
  • 51fa96a3872f2622cc05ca5bce09a891f4842a1b72e57d1a5fd2790dc2bd650a:1
  • value  15750322
    address  16NeES1aAJ7mAbYFJzpLHAgeSvzthp1TMm